{{{
$ cat A.hs
module A
where
foo :: [a] -> a
foo = id
$ ghc -c A.hs
A.hs:5:0:
Occurs check: cannot construct the infinite type: a = [a]
When generalising the type(s) for `foo'
}}}
It would be nice if GHC could give more information about where and how
the error is being generated, for example which expressions are making it
try to unify a and [a]. (Especially in more complicated functions, it can
be difficult to track down the bug.)
